hollandis: Why are countries taking advantage of corners My dear unlike our regressive football system. Most counties are practising and perfecting set pieces now, it’s another efficient way to get goals if you can’t get one during play, as you can see during this World Cup underdog teams are giving the big teams run for their money, matching them play for play. If you are a tennis fan, this is akin to players perfecting their serve, because they know they can steal ‘free’ points from Aces. |

It was in the article she had a donor egg IVF NOT artificial insemination, some or all of her hymen has to make way for the catheter that will transfer the embryo to her uterine wall. She has a medical condition where she is unable to have sex ( she has no reproductive function) hence the donor egg as she can not produce any eggs. She used a donor egg and a donor sperm, both were fertilized in a petri dish. The resulting embryo was transferred into her uterus. |
